Lucid Software is hiring an Accounts Receivable Analyst II to enhance financial management and efficient operations within their Accounting team while ensuring top-notch customer service and collaboration across teams.
Responsibilities: Main responsibilities include handling collections, providing exceptional customer service, generating analytical reports, becoming an expert in billing systems, and ensuring data integrity in accounts receivable.
Skills: The ideal candidate should possess strong analytical skills, technical proficiency in spreadsheets and billing systems, excellent communication capabilities, detail-oriented problem-solving skills, and a collaborative spirit.
Qualifications: Preferred qualifications include familiarity with software like NetSuite and experience in a SaaS company or customer service background.
Location: The position is based in Raleigh, NC, with hybrid work options available.
Compensation: Not provided by employer. Typical compensation ranges for this position are between $55,000 - $75,000.
